The South Carolina Gamecocks (26-3) will try to extend a three-game winning streak when they host the Kentucky Wildcats (22-5) at 2 p.m. ET on Sunday, March 2, 2025 at Colonial Life Arena. The game airs on ESPN.

Kentucky’s Top Players
Name | GP | PTS | REB | ASST | STL | BLK | 3PM |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Georgia Amoore | 27 | 18.9 | 2.1 | 7 | 1 | 0.3 | 2.4 |
Clara Strack | 27 | 15 | 9.6 | 2.7 | 0.7 | 2.5 | 0.5 |
Dazia Lawrence | 27 | 12.9 | 2.3 | 2.2 | 0.9 | 0.1 | 2.2 |
Teonni Key | 27 | 11.7 | 8.3 | 1.6 | 0.9 | 1.7 | 0.3 |
Amelia Hassett | 27 | 9.2 | 8.1 | 2 | 1 | 1.1 | 1.9 |
